Today, the most accepted theory for evolution is the 'synthetic theory'. According to this theory the origin of new species depends upon the interaction of genetic variations and natural selection (environmental conditions).

The Modern Synthetic theory of Evolution explains the evolution of life in terms of genetic changes occurring in the populations that leads to the formation of new species. It also explains the genetic population or Mendelian population, gene pool and the gene frequency. The concepts coming under this synthetic theory of evolution includes the genetic variations, reproductive and geographical isolation and the natural selection.
